#3 - Separate the seersucker suit separates. Think “sport coat + pants”, rather than “suit”. Seersucker can and should be experienced not only as a suit, but also as separate pieces. You will get twice as much wear and discover new, easy ways to style your seersucker. A seersucker sport coat paired with jeans and a knit polo, or a cotton tee, is a great look. Seersucker pants can be worn with a casual shirt and either cowboy boots or matching sneakers. Still want to go full suit styled with a crisp shirt, a colorful tie, and a pocket square.
#4 – Wear seersucker year-round. While a light-colored striped seersucker suit may be more traditional during the hottest months, our darker seersucker hues or pairing the lighter hues with solid seersucker pants will give you plenty of styles you will feel comfortable in all year long. Seersucker, being made of cotton, is also great for lightweight layering. Escaping to the islands or attending a destination wedding? Pack the seersucker. There’s no such thing as “no seersucker after Labor Day.”

#9 – Do not iron your seersucker. I’ll say it again, do not iron your seersucker. Don’t do it. The unique pucker is part of seersucker’s charm, much like its lightweight cousin…linen. If you embrace the wrinkled linen charm, you’re sure to love the seersucker pucker. If your seersucker look needs a little refreshing, the steamer setting on your iron should do the trick. And guys, please take your seersucker to the dry cleaners occasionally, but be sure to tell them, “Don't press my seersucker!”
